Casement or slider? Choose by how the room works
Visual planning reference

At a glance

01

Casement

Projects outward; strong ventilation control and compression-style closing.

02

Slider

Stays within the wall plane; practical where exterior clearance is limited.

03

Fixed

Best when daylight and view matter but ventilation is not required.

The useful decision

Compare operation, ventilation, exterior clearance, cleaning and the view before choosing a frame style.

01

Begin with the opening

A casement projects outward and closes against compression-style seals. A slider stays within the wall plane and is often practical beside walks, decks and other tight exterior areas.

02

Compare everyday use

Consider reach, furniture, screens, cleaning access and how much ventilation the room needs. A fixed companion unit can preserve more glass where operation is unnecessary.

03

Confirm the complete unit

Series, size, glass package and installation conditions all affect the final choice. Confirm the exact configuration rather than selecting from operating style alone.

Bring this to the conversation

Project checklist

  • Check exterior clearance near decks, paths and landscaping.
  • Test whether the operator is comfortable to reach.
  • Decide how much ventilation the room actually needs.
  • Confirm screen location, cleaning access and egress requirements.

Avoid assumptions

Questions worth answering

  1. Which side should open for useful airflow?
  2. Will furniture or a counter affect reach?
  3. Does the opening need to satisfy an egress requirement?
